Output c4d781257881991f6e203e65d8553d88b9d7430aee31c447638de47e020c9935:10

value
698590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0a960051beec58528130bbb615206191c80170 OP_EQUAL
address
3HZGBSr14aPdYDHC8yhxELczvdKb4tiTMA
transaction
c4d781257881991f6e203e65d8553d88b9d7430aee31c447638de47e020c9935
spent
true